Hallett - Gertrude Summers



Source: Crawfordsville Journal Review - 1 Oct 1975 p2

Mrs. Gertrude L. HALLETT, 92, of Waynetown died at 11:10 a.m. Tuesday Sept 30, 1975 at Culver Hospital, Crawfordsville. She had been a patient there since Monday. She resided at Lane House Nursing home, Crawfordsville for two years. Mrs. Hallett was born October 21, 1882 near Wallace, the daughter of Joseph and Lear Wagner Summers Hallet. On Feb 9, 1902 she was married to Charles Hallett in Wallace. He died in 1956. Survivors include a brother, Mark Summers of Wallace; several nieces and nephews; five grandchildren and 11 greats. Two sons, Lacy and Oral; two brothers, Cyril Summers and Byron Summers, a sister, Mrs. Bessie Cates, preceded Mrs. Hallet in death. Mrs. Hallett, who operated the Waynetown Hardware Store with her husband resided in Waynetown since 1937. She attended the Waynetown Baptist Church and was a member of Scott Prairie Baptist Church. She was a 50 year member of the OES 415 in Wallace. She was educated in Fountain County Schools. Services will be at 11 a.m. Friday at Thomas Funeral Home with the Rev. Stephen Malone officiating. Burial in Waynetown Masonic Cemetery. Friends may call after 4 p.m. Thursday at the funeral Home. - kbz


Source: Crawfordsville Journal-Review 2 October 1975 p 2 ? it is marked Oct 6 but that would be after the funeral ?

Waynetown - Mrs. Gertrude L. Hallett, 92 of Waynetown died at 11:10 a.m. Tuesday in Culver Hospital where she had been a patient for a day.  She had been a resident in Lane House at Crawfordsville for two years.  She had lived at Waynetown since 1937 when she and her husband moved there from Fountain County. They operated the Hallett Brothers Hardware Store at Waynetown.  Mrs. Hallett was a member of Scotts Prairie Christian Church and attended Waynetown Baptist Church. She was a 50-year member of the Wallace Order of Eastern Star 415.  

Born Oct 2, 1882 near Wallace, she was a daughter of Joseph and Lear Wagoner Summers.  She married Charles Hallett of Wallace on Feb 19, 1902.  He died in october of 1956.  Surviving is a brother, Marx Summers of Wallace; five grandchildren, Donald Hallett of Portage, Mich; Richard Hallett of Alexandria, Ind; Mrs. Lora Nichols of Alamo; Mrs. Connie Rutledge of Germany and Ruth Ann Hallett of Rt 1, Waynetown; 11 great grandchildren and nieces and nephews.  Two sons, Lacey who died in January of this year and Oral who died in 1972 and two brothers and a sister are deceased.  Services will be at 11 a.m. Friday in Thomas Funeral Home with Rev. Stephen Malone officiating. Burial will be in Waynetown Masonic Cemetery. Friends may call at the funeral home after 4 pm. Thursday, Eastern star rites will be conducted by the Wallace Chapter at 7:30 p.m. Thursday.
